Output 43ab123dba65cc3bc0027f234068c848f26a99035ab2e59e27923f95dd72016b:0

value
9467405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d5c78c9669bf2293b544b2770ed65a01a10b6ca OP_EQUALVERIFY OP_CHECKSIG
address
12DeZYpr2SVSRk1Mc8QgquRxDDwouFB5xJ
transaction
43ab123dba65cc3bc0027f234068c848f26a99035ab2e59e27923f95dd72016b
spent
true